Index: www/quark/Makefile =================================================================== --- www/quark/Makefile +++ www/quark/Makefile @@ -3,7 +3,8 @@ PORTNAME= quark DISTVERSION= g20190923 CATEGORIES= www -MASTER_SITES= https://people.freebsd.org/~0mp/distfiles/ +MASTER_SITES= LOCAL/0mp \ + https://people.freebsd.org/~0mp/distfiles/ PKGNAMESUFFIX= -server DISTNAME= ${PKGNAME} @@ -13,9 +14,11 @@ LICENSE= ISCL LICENSE_FILE= ${WRKSRC}/LICENSE +MAKE_ARGS= MANPREFIX=${PREFIX}/man + CONFLICTS_INSTALL= quark -MAKE_ARGS= MANPREFIX=${PREFIX}/man +NO_WRKSUBDIR= yes PLIST_FILES= bin/quark \ man/man1/quark.1.gz @@ -43,13 +46,11 @@ post-install: @${STRIP_CMD} ${STAGEDIR}${PREFIX}/bin/quark -regenerate-distfile: +_regenerate-distfile: ${RM} -r -- ${PKGNAME} git clone -n https://git.suckless.org/quark ${PKGNAME} - git -C ${PKGNAME} checkout ${COMMIT_HASH} - ${RM} -r -- ${PKGNAME}/.git - ${TAR} -czf ${PKGNAME}.tar.gz ${PKGNAME} - scp ${PKGNAME}.tar.gz 0mp@freefall.freebsd.org:~/public_html/distfiles - ${RM} -r -- ${PKGNAME} ${PKGNAME}.tar.gz + git -C ${PKGNAME} archive --output=${PKGNAME}.tar.gz ${COMMIT_HASH} + scp ${PKGNAME}/${PKGNAME}.tar.gz 0mp@freefall.freebsd.org:~/public_html/distfiles + scp ${PKGNAME}/${PKGNAME}.tar.gz 0mp@freefall.freebsd.org:~/public_distfiles .include Index: www/quark/distinfo =================================================================== --- www/quark/distinfo +++ www/quark/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1571571885 -SHA256 (quark-server-g20190923.tar.gz) = 3c50e52d8e6f8f939cd02e3a94368a22c3f723606b7c486bb30cec8f1dc09b5e -SIZE (quark-server-g20190923.tar.gz) = 14101 +TIMESTAMP = 1574520204 +SHA256 (quark-server-g20190923.tar.gz) = c37b264f694d1f02349c6314ae1fa9c781243540c0365ab06b3e9e22c0b8a88f +SIZE (quark-server-g20190923.tar.gz) = 13996